Output 32d5ff794ea59a028641b261ec9552a4eb8140942f5e2111e828fc01891f26e1:58

value
175277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af3d5afd6871c28ddc6b54e911d40690333c5ee OP_EQUAL
address
349XbTtBjKLiSHKVyfeeyWXqF9E784iU4K
transaction
32d5ff794ea59a028641b261ec9552a4eb8140942f5e2111e828fc01891f26e1
spent
true